1. A method comprising:
receiving, by a wireless device, at least one radio resource control (RRC) message comprising:
a first parameter indicating a starting symbol for a physical downlink channel; and
a second parameter indicating one possible starting position, for transmission in a time duration, is one slot; and
receiving, via the physical downlink channel, a signal, wherein the physical downlink channel starts from a symbol that is based on the starting symbol and the second parameter.
